2015-08-19 28 views

回答

1

在map-reduce作業中,如果設置了4個reducer來實現reducer作業。通過這樣做,最終的輸出將生成4個部分文件。像部分-R-00001部分-R-00002部分-R-00003部分-R-00004。希望這可以澄清你的疑惑。

+1

非常感謝解釋,所以如果我們有多個減速器,說如果我必須計算一個統一的價值,說一個最大數量,我將如何做到這一點?說如果我有4個減速器,那麼輸出將是基於分區的不同減速器的4個最大數量? –

+0

在這種情況下,您爲什麼需要使用減速機? Mapper可以處理您的請求。 –

+0

Mapper服務器如何能夠整合請求?我們將有多個映射器爲一個Job提供服務,這會生成關鍵值對,聚合發生在哪裏?即使我們使用組合器,它也將特定於映射器的輸出。這有點混亂,你能否詳細說明你的答案?謝謝! –